Mr. Kamen Iliev, Director of the Center for National Security and Defense Research at the Bulgarian Academy of Sciences (BAS) had the honor of attending the solemn ceremony on the occasion of the 130th anniversary of the founding of the Bulgarian Chamber of Commerce and Industry (BCCI).
The ceremony, which took place on December 3 in Sofia, gathered over 200 guests and highlighted the long-standing contribution of the BCCI as one of the oldest and most active business institutions in Bulgaria and the Balkan Peninsula.
Highlights of the ceremony:
• The event was honored by the President of the Republic of Bulgaria, Mr. Rumen Radev, who presented the Chamber with the Honorary Badge of the President, in recognition of its contribution to the development of the modern economy and the expansion of foreign trade relations.
• Also present were Prince Boris Tarnovski, ambassadors, representatives of diplomatic missions, as well as leading industry organizations.
• Special awards were presented to companies with a long history and a sustainable presence in the Bulgarian economy, as well as to individuals and media with contributions to the Chamber’s activities.
